A very explosive issue is the potential for China to move against Taiwan. Over the weekend, Japan stated very clearly that any action by China against Taiwan would trigger a response from Japan. On these concerns, Gold moved above $5,000 per ounce in India. Gold saw some profit-taking in London, but by the close of London trading, it reached a high of $5,048 per ounce.

At 11 am PT today, gold is trading at $5,064, up by $103 over last week.

SILVER

Silver reached a low of $77.89 in overseas trading last night before major buying emerged, pushing prices to a high of $82.59 per ounce. Trading volume in Silver is improving, and we should no longer see the sharp price drops experienced recently. Investors are now waiting for key economic indicators for clues on the Federal Reserve’s policy direction in the coming months. The Fed closely monitors both the labor market and inflation when setting monetary policy.

At 11 am PT today, silver is trading at $83.17, up by $5.67 over last week.
